DAAPPP Data Set No. 25

1981 U.S. Survey of Title X-Funded Family Planning Clinics
Roberta Herceg-Baron

This file contains data on the scope of family planning clinic efforts to involve parents in family planning for teenagers. The study sample is based on a 1981 national survey of 351 Title X recipients. Data obtained via telephone interviews included information on agency characteristics, parental involvement activities, and parental consent or notification policies.

Note for users of DAAPPP Data Sets #01-B1

DAAPPP data sets 01 through B1 (NATASHA 1) are comprised of a User's Guide, SPSS syntax files (*.SPS or *.SPX) and raw data files only. Most of these datasets contain SPSS syntax files that use Job Control Language (JCL) from 1980s versions of SPSS-X. Because the syntax is old, the syntax files require editing to conform to the current syntax standards used by SPSS/Windows or SPSS/Unix.
